Horse Fence Replacement in Roseville, CA

Horse fence replacement services involve removing and installing fencing specifically designed to contain and secure horses on residential or rural properties. These projects often include replacing worn, damaged, or outdated fencing with new materials such as wood, vinyl, or wire to ensure safety and durability. Homeowners typically request this service when existing fences have become compromised due to weather, age, or wear, or when upgrading to a more secure or visually appealing fencing solution.

Property owners should consider factors such as the type of fencing material that best suits their needs, the size of the area to be enclosed, and any local regulations or property restrictions before requesting horse fence replacement. It is also helpful to understand the maintenance requirements of different fencing options and how the new fencing will integrate with existing structures or landscape features. Proper planning can help ensure the new fence provides long-lasting security and complements the property's overall appearance.

FAQ

Horse Fence Replacement Questions

What types of fences are suitable for horse properties? Wooden, vinyl, and pipe fences are common options for horse enclosures, providing durability and safety.

When should horse fence replacement be considered? Replacement is recommended when fences are damaged, leaning, or no longer secure, to ensure horse safety.

Are there specific height requirements for horse fences? Fences typically need to be at least 4.5 to 5 feet high to prevent horses from escaping.

What materials are best for long-lasting horse fences? Treated wood, vinyl, and metal pipe fences are known for their longevity and low maintenance needs.
